I personally (somewhat old school) would like to see a return to eight-team leagues. In my sims I have one Wild Card in each League, so only 8 of 32 teams in the playoffs. MLB would never do that, of course. I guessed at Buffalo (the WildWings) and Charlotte (the Hive) as the two expansion teams.

NL East = ATL, PHL, NYM, CHA, WSH, PIT, CIN, MIA
NL West = LAD, SF, SD, COL, AZ, STL, MLW, CHC
AL East = BUF, NYY, BOS, CLV, BLT, TBY, TOR, DET
AL West = LV, LAA, SEA, KC, HOU, TEX, MIN, CWS

Problems here include the Chicago teams in the West, and the Florida teams isolated from mostly northern teams in their leagues. On the latter, could switch TBY and WAS, so that travel would be less, and build up regional interest with ATL, CHA, TBY, MIA. Could also group by north/south instead. Basically same distances flying, but with time zones.

NL North = NYM, PHL, PIT, CHC, MLW, SF, COL, CIN
NL South = ATL, CHA, WSH, MIA, LA, SD, ARZ, STL
AL North = BOS, NYY, BUF, CLV, DET, CWS, MIN, TOR
AL South = TBY, BLT, KC, HOU, TEX, LAA, LVA, SEA

Works great until you are down to finding one more southern team. Seattle? Much closer to LVA ad LAA than Toronto.

Maybe lose the league identifications?

Northeast = TOR, BOS, NYY, NYM, PHL, CLV, BUF, PIT
Southeast = ATL, MIA, TBY, CHA, CIN, WSH, STL, BLT
Northwest = SEA, SF, COL, MIN, CHC, CHW, MLW, DET
Southwest = SDP, LAA, LAD, ARZ, HOU, TEX, LVA, KCR

Looks great until you get to STL in the Southeast, and MLW and DET in the Northwest, plus KCR in the Southwest a bit of a stretch.

Maybe put the expansion teams in more convenient places?
